Transaction 51a52ebd3e8c7c47a64a00186d6592268ca5734d1d28ea218c0b61eecedb23cc

1 Input
2 Outputs
  • 51a52ebd3e8c7c47a64a00186d6592268ca5734d1d28ea218c0b61eecedb23cc:0
  • value  10964485
    address  3H8ddf1W2atS4EZAWYf3C4ZG4cAR47hsiK
  • 51a52ebd3e8c7c47a64a00186d6592268ca5734d1d28ea218c0b61eecedb23cc:1
  • value  13965000
    address  3JMdzj52gMN8uZPfE92xaqWPXgeGutrB4C